Output 8145101ef73e537ccda4ae22680519c3ddc0e943a47d647dda6d71dee768833d:3

value
246437
script pubkey
OP_0 OP_PUSHBYTES_20 150b4e2d359462cfac5927bf939a9065f385c89a
address
bc1qz595utf4j33vltzey7le8x5svhectjy65fah8l
transaction
8145101ef73e537ccda4ae22680519c3ddc0e943a47d647dda6d71dee768833d
spent
true